1 To the chief Musician, A Psalm [or] Song of David. Let God arise, let his enemies be scattered: let them also that hate him flee before him.
Dura buʼaa faarfattootaatiif. Faarfannaa Daawit. Waaqni haa kaʼu; diinonni isaas haa bittinnaaʼan; warri isa jibbanis fuula isaa duraa haa baqatan.
2 As smoke is driven away, [so] drive [them] away: as wax melteth before the fire, [so] let the wicked perish at the presence of God.
Akkuma aarri bittinnaaʼu, ati isaan bittinneessi; akkuma gagaan ibidda duratti baqu, hamoonni fuula Waaqaa duraa haa badan.
3 But let the righteous be glad; let them rejoice before God: yea, let them exceedingly rejoice.
Qajeelonni garuu haa gammadan; fuula Waaqaa durattis baayʼee haa gammadan; isaan gammachuudhaan haa ililchan.
4 Sing unto God, sing praises to his name: extol him that rideth upon the heavens by his name Jah, and rejoice before him.
Waaqaaf faarfadhaa; faarfannaa galataa maqaa isaatiif faarfadhaa; isa duumessaan gulufu sana jajadhaa; maqaan isaa Waaqayyoo dha; fuula isaa durattis baayʼee gammadaa.
5 A father of the fatherless, and a judge of the widows, [is] God in his holy habitation.
Waaqni warra abbaa hin qabneef abbaa, niitota dhirsoonni irraa duʼaniifis falmaa taʼe sun iddoo jireenya isaa qulqulluu keessa jira.
6 God setteth the solitary in families: he bringeth out those which are bound with chains: but the rebellious dwell in a dry [land].
Waaqni warra kophaa taʼan maatii keessa jiraachisa; warra hidhamanis mana hidhaatii baasa; finciltoonni garuu lafa gogaa irra jiraatu.
7 O God, when thou wentest forth before thy people, when thou didst march through the wilderness; (Selah)
Yaa Waaqayyo, gaafa ati saba kee dura baate, gaafa ati gammoojjii keessa dabarte,
8 The earth shook, the heavens also dropped at the presence of God: [even] Sinai itself [was moved] at the presence of God, the God of Israel.
fuula Waaqaa, Waaqa Siinaa duratti, fuula Waaqaa, Waaqa Israaʼel duratti, lafti ni raafamte; samiiwwanis bokkaa roobsan.
9 Thou, O God, didst send a plentiful rain, whereby thou didst confirm thine inheritance, when it was weary.
Yaa Waaqayyo, ati bokkaa baayʼee roobsite; dhaala kee kan dadhabe illee ni quubsite.
10 Thy congregation hath dwelt therein: thou, O God, hast prepared of thy goodness for the poor.
Sabni kee achi qubate; yaa Waaqayyo, ati badhaadhummaa kee keessaa hiyyeeyyii soorte.
11 The Lord gave the word: great [was] the company of those that published [it].
Gooftaan dubbii isaa kenne; dubartoonni dubbii sana labsanis baayʼee dha:
12 Kings of armies did flee apace: and she that tarried at home divided the spoil.
“Mootonnii fi loltoonni ariitiin baqatan; dubartoonni qeʼee oolan boojuu qooddatan.
13 Though ye have lien among the pots, [yet shall ye be as] the wings of a dove covered with silver, and her feathers with yellow gold.
Yoo gola hoolotaa gidduutti argamtan illee, isin akka gugee qoochoon ishee meetiidhaan uffifamee baalleen ishee immoo warqee calaqqisuun uffifamee ti.”
14 When the Almighty scattered kings in it, it was [white] as snow in Salmon.
Yommuu Waaqni Waan Hunda Dandaʼu mootota achitti bittinneessetti, Zalmoon irratti cabbiin buʼe.
15 The hill of God [is as] the hill of Bashan; an high hill [as] the hill of Bashan.
Yaa tulluu Baashaan, yaa tulluu surra qabeessa, yaa Tulluu Baashaan, yaa tulluu fiixee baayʼee qabu,
16 Why leap ye, ye high hills? [this is] the hill [which] God desireth to dwell in; yea, the LORD will dwell [in it] for ever.
yaa tulluu fiixee baayʼee qabdu, ati maaliif tulluu Waaqni bulchuuf filate, iddoo Waaqayyo bara baraan jiraatu sana hinaaffaadhaan ilaalta?
17 The chariots of God [are] twenty thousand, [even] thousands of angels: the Lord [is] among them, [as in] Sinai, in the holy [place].
Gaariiwwan Waaqaa kuma hedduu dha; isaan kumaatama yeroo kumaatamaa ti; Gooftaanis Siinaadhaa gara iddoo qulqulluu dhufeera.
18 Thou hast ascended on high, thou hast led captivity captive: thou hast received gifts for men; yea, [for] the rebellious also, that the LORD God might dwell [among them].
Ati yommuu ol gubbaa baatetti boojuu baayʼee fudhate; yaa Waaqayyo, yaa Waaqi, ati achi jiraachuuf jettee, namoota irraa, finciltoota irraas kennaa fudhatte.
19 Blessed [be] the Lord, [who] daily loadeth us [with benefits, even] the God of our salvation. (Selah)
Gooftaan guyyuma guyyaan baʼaa keenya baatu, Waaqni Fayyissaa keenya taʼe sun haa eebbifamu.
20 [He that is] our God [is] the God of salvation; and unto GOD the Lord [belong] the issues from death.
Waaqni keenya Waaqa fayyinaa ti; duʼa jalaa baʼuunis Waaqayyo Goofticha biraa dhufa.
21 But God shall wound the head of his enemies, [and] the hairy scalp of such an one as goeth on still in his trespasses.
Waaqni dhugumaan mataa diina isaa, gubbee mataa warra cubbuu isaaniitti fufanii kan rifeensa qabu ni caccabsa.
22 The Lord said, I will bring again from Bashan, I will bring [my people] again from the depths of the sea:
Gooftaan akkana jedha; “Ani deebisee Baashaanii isaan nan fida; tuujuba galaanaa keessaas deebisee isaan nan fida;
23 That thy foot may be dipped in the blood of [thine] enemies, [and] the tongue of thy dogs in the same.
kunis akka ati dhiiga diinota keetii miilla keetiin borcituuf; arrabni saroota keetiis akka qooda isaanii qabaatuuf.”
24 They have seen thy goings, O God; [even] the goings of my God, my King, in the sanctuary.
Yaa Waaqayyo, hiriirri kee mulʼateera; hiriirri Waaqa kootiitii fi mootii kootii iddoo qulqulluutti ol galeera.
25 The singers went before, the players on instruments [followed] after; among [them were] the damsels playing with timbrels.
Fuula duraan faarfattoota, dugda duubaan immoo warra muuziiqaa taphatantu ture; dubartoonni dibbee rukutanis gidduu isaanii turan.
26 Bless ye God in the congregations, [even] the Lord, from the fountain of Israel.
Waldaa guddaa keessatti Waaqa jajadhaa; yaaʼii Israaʼel keessattis Waaqayyoon jajadhaa.
27 There [is] little Benjamin [with] their ruler, the princes of Judah [and] their council, the princes of Zebulun, [and] the princes of Naphtali.
Beniyaam gosti xinnichi isaan dura deema; tuunni ilmaan mootota Yihuudaas achi turan; ilmaan mootota Zebuuloonii fi Niftaalemis achi turan.
28 Thy God hath commanded thy strength: strengthen, O God, that which thou hast wrought for us.
Yaa Waaqayyo, humna kee ajaji; yaa Waaqa keenya, akkuma duraan goote sana jabina kee nu argisiisi.
29 Because of thy temple at Jerusalem shall kings bring presents unto thee.
Sababii mana qulqullummaa keetii kan Yerusaalem keessaatiif mootonni kennaa siif fidu.
30 Rebuke the company of spearmen, the multitude of the bulls, with the calves of the people, [till every one] submit himself with pieces of silver: scatter thou the people [that] delight in war.
Bineensota shambaqqoo keessaa, karra korommii jabboota sabootaa keessaas ifadhu. Warra meetii fidan gad deebisi. Warra waraanatti gammadanis bittinneessi.
31 Princes shall come out of Egypt; Ethiopia shall soon stretch out her hands unto God.
Ergamoonni Gibxi ni dhufu; Itoophiyaanis daftee harka ishee Waaqatti balʼifatti.
32 Sing unto God, ye kingdoms of the earth; O sing praises unto the Lord; (Selah)
Yaa mootummoota lafaa, Waaqa faarfadhaa; faarfannaa galataas Gooftaadhaaf faarfadhaa;
33 To him that rideth upon the heavens of heavens, [which were] of old; lo, he doth send out his voice, [and that] a mighty voice.
isa samiiwwan durii keessa gulufu, isa sagalee jabaadhaan qaqawweessaʼu sana faarfadhaa.
34 Ascribe ye strength unto God: his excellency [is] over Israel, and his strength [is] in the clouds.
Waaqa ulfinni isaa Israaʼel irra jiru, isa miidhaginni isaa samiiwwan keessa jiru sana humna isaa labsaa.
35 O God, [thou art] terrible out of thy holy places: the God of Israel [is] he that giveth strength and power unto [his] people. Blessed [be] God.
Yaa Waaqayyo, ati iddoo qulqullummaa keetiitti sodaachisaa dha; Waaqni Israaʼel saba isaatiif humnaa fi jabina ni kenna. Waaqni haa eebbifamu!
